2024-Q3 rotation: Rotated the deploy key for Streetwise, the address autocomplete widget. Previous key retired after the scheduled 90-day window. Widget bundles published after version 3.8.2 are signed with the new key; the CDN edge validators were updated at the same time. If you redeploy an older bundle during an incident, re-sign it first. The current deploy key follows.

deploy key for kajof-fajop: bky6_gDHw9Q

Before sign-off, confirm the Chalkrow timetable solver runs inside the restricted sandbox with no filesystem writes outside its scratch directory. Review the constraint-import path for untrusted spreadsheet parsing, and verify the fuzz suite passed on the release candidate. The solver must refuse timetable definitions exceeding the documented size cap rather than attempting partial allocation. Sign-off requires matching the deployed artifact against our provenance ledger; the candidate's trace token is recorded directly below for comparison.

build token for tahop-fafof: htk14_2d55df8101eccc

Welcome to the SproutCycle team. The watering scheduler calls our internal MoistureHub service to fetch soil-sensor readings before composing each schedule. All calls are authenticated and logged; keys rotate monthly and are scoped read-only. For your review environment, we've provisioned a sandbox credential with identical scopes, included directly below.

gateway credential: qvz7-6l0tyM5